Cygnet Group are looking for a confident, caring and motivated Learning Disabilities Support Worker to join our friendly team at Devon Lodge. If you’re passionate about helping others live fulfilling, independent lives, this is a role where you can genuinely make a difference every single day. We are offering a 42‑hour contract, working a variety of daytime shifts. Some shifts may start at 7 am, while others may finish at 10 pm, across a 7‑day rota (including two weekends per month ). Devon Lodge is a specialist residential service for adults with autism and learning disabilities, who may have behaviours that challenge. We aim to provide a safe, comfortable and effective environment, promoting independence and community integration. Person-centred planning is at the heart of everything we do, based on each person’s specific needs. We understand that consistency and continuity of care is important for the individuals we care for. What You’ll Be Doing Providing person‑centred, flexible support tailored to each individual Offering emotional and practical guidance to help people thrive Supporting with daily living skills, personal care and wellbeing needs Assisting with medical and welfare requirements Recording and reporting on health, progress and any concerns Safeguarding and promoting the safety and dignity of those in your care Helping maintain a clean, safe and positive environment Why Join Cygnet? Salary: £12.86 – £13.63 per hour Opportunities for overtime Regular coaching, appraisal and development Expert supervision and strong peer support A role where your work has real purpose and impact Free meals on shift You’ll Be Someone Who… Is genuinely driven to make a meaningful difference Communicates well and works confidently as part of a team Is compassionate, intuitive and supportive Brings energy and positivity to create a safe, stimulating environment Is passionate about empowering individuals to live more independently Please note that successful candidates will be required to undergo an enhanced DBS check.
